AAP’s Amanatullah Khan denies absconding, writes to Delhi Police Commissioner

In a significant operation by Delhi Police, the Crime Branch and Special Cell raided nearly a dozen locations across Delhi, Rajasthan, and Uttar Pradesh, targeting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) leader Amanatullah Khan as part of their efforts to arrest him.
Khan’s Mobile Phone Turned Off; AAP Leaders Allegedly Assisting
Sources indicated that Khan’s mobile phone is switched off, and several AAP leaders are suspected to be offering support in helping him avoid capture. The police are intensifying their surveillance on these activities while tracking his whereabouts.
Police Conduct Multiple Raids in Meerut
As part of the search operation, Meerut, Uttar Pradesh, became a focal point, with raids conducted in the area due to Khan’s known connections there. Delhi Police teams are collaborating with local authorities to track his movements.
Police Confident About Khan’s Imminent Arrest
The Delhi Police has expressed confidence that they are closing in on Amanatullah Khan and that the intensified search operation will continue until his arrest.
MCOCA Charges Likely After Arrest
Legal sources revealed that authorities are preparing to invoke the Maharashtra Control of Organised Crime Act (MCOCA) against Khan after his arrest. This suggests that serious charges are expected, with the law typically applied in cases involving organized crime and extensive criminal activities.
Khan’s Last Known Location and Police Suspicion
- Khan’s mobile phone was last traced to Meethapur, after which his phone was switched off.
- Police suspect AAP leaders may be assisting Khan in evading capture.
- The search operation continues, with police confident of his imminent arrest.
Amanatullah Khan Denies Absconding
Amidst the police operation, Amanatullah Khan wrote to the Delhi Police Commissioner, asserting:
- He is not absconding and remains in his constituency.
- Certain Delhi Police officials are allegedly trying to frame him in a fabricated case.
- The individual the police originally sought to arrest has already been granted bail, and police are now targeting Khan with false allegations in an attempt to cover up their error.
Delhi Police Yet to Respond
While Amanatullah Khan’s letter raises serious allegations, Delhi Police have yet to comment officially on his claims. The search continues, and updates on the operation are expected in the coming days.
